기타언어초록

A moderately halophilic bacterial strain $15-13^T$, which was isolated from soda meadow saline soil in Daqing City, Heilongjiang Province, China, was subjected to a polyphasic taxonomic study. The cells of strain $15-13^T$ were found to be Gram-negative, rod-shaped, and motile. The required growth conditions for strain $15-13^T$ were: 1-23% NaCl (optimum, 7%), 10-$50^{circ}C$ (optimum, $35^{circ}C$), and pH 7.0-11.0 (optimum, pH 9.5). The predominant cellular fatty acids were $C_{18:1}$ ${omega}7c$ (60.48%) and $C_{16:0}$ (13.96%). The DNA G+C content was 67.6 mol%. Phylogenetic analysis based on 16S rRNA gene sequence comparisons indicated that strain $15-13^T$ clustered within a branch comprising species of the genus Halomonas. The closest phylogenetic neighbor of strain $15-13^T$ was Halomonas pantelleriensis DSM $9661^T$ (98.9% 16S rRNA gene sequence similarity). The level of DNA-DNA relatedness between the novel isolated strain and H. pantelleriensis DSM $9661^T$ was 33.8%. On the basis of the phenotypic and phylogenetic data, strain $15-13^T$ represents a novel species of the genus Halomonas, for which the name Halomonas alkalitolerans sp. nov. is proposed. The type strain for this novel species is $15-13^T$ (=CGMCC $1.9129^T$ =NBRC $106539^T$).
